Output 326c74c0818a48be8dd628338f22af4d56dcf0dd0c80fab83adddaf7b04f4859:0

value
15835361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af64a6ae49de1fbd7b7f9baa5aef903e3b574eaf OP_EQUAL
address
3HgQkUVoAVaMHybE3t1r85wdw6VniBDSYq
transaction
326c74c0818a48be8dd628338f22af4d56dcf0dd0c80fab83adddaf7b04f4859
confirmations
306691
spent
true